Real estate tycoon Manuel Villar drops plans for foreign partner in new Philippines casino venture: report

Philippine businessman Manuel Villar Jr (pictured in a file photo) has reportedly dropped plans to involve a foreign partner in his project to enter the casino market in that country.

Media outlet InsiderPH said – citing the real estate entrepreneur – that talks to tie to a foreign partner had fallen through.

In 2023 commentary, he had mentioned involving a South Korean group that wasn’t identified by name.

Mr Villar had been cited as observing in the 2023 remarks, the possibility of developing two Metro Manila casinos, both within Villar City.

The latter is a large-scale real estate development in the National Capital Region, being promoted by Villar Group. The master plan for Villar City is said also to include a central business district, a theme park, and a zone for higher educations.

Last year, Mr Villar had mentioned opening a first casino during 2025.

The Villar Group was said to have obtained a gaming licence during the time of the previous administration led by President Rodrigo Duterte. The group has yet to launch any gaming operations in the country.

The latest InsiderPH report cited Mr Villar mentioning a single casino that would be at the renovated Vista Mall Global South in Las Piñas, Villar City.

“The structure is finished. It’s a mall that I converted. We own the land, we own the structure,” he was quoted mentioning. The report mentioned no proposed opening date for the project.

The InsiderPH report stated Mr Villar hoped that venture would push up valuations in the south of Metro Manila, including the 3,500-hectare (8,649-acre) Villar City project.

Real estate entrepreneur Mr Villar was ranked third on the Forbes ‘Philippines’ 50 Richest’ list for 2024, with a net worth estimated at US$10.9 billion.

Above him were two entrants that already have casino interests in their portfolios. They were: ports investor Enrique Razon, chairman of casino developer Bloomberry Resorts Corp who was in second spot with US$11.1 billion; and the “Sy siblings” in first place with US$13.0 billion. They count casino investor Alliance Global Group Inc and the related Travellers International Hotel Group Inc among their interests.
